Bacterial lipopolysaccharides (LPSs) have been shown to promote enteric viral infections. This study tested the hypothesis that elevated levels of bacterial LPS improve oral rotavirus vaccine replication in South African infants. Stool samples were collected from infants a week after rotavirus vaccination to identify vaccine virus shedders (n = 43) and non-shedders (n = 35). Quantitative real-time PCR was used to assay for selected LPS-rich bacteria, including Serratia marcescens, Pseudomonas aeruguinosa and Klebsiella pneumonia, and to measure the gene expression of bacterial LPS, host Toll-like Receptor 4 (TLR4) and Interleukin-8 (IL-8). The abundance of selected LPS-rich bacteria was significantly higher in vaccine shedders (median log 4.89 CFU/g, IQR 2.84) compared to non-shedders (median log 3.13 CFU/g, IQR 2.74), p = 0.006. The TLR4 and IL-8 gene expressions were increased four- and two-fold, respectively, in vaccine shedders versus non-shedders, but no difference was observed in the bacterial LPS expression, p = 0.09. A regression analysis indicated a significant association between the abundance of selected LPS-rich bacteria and vaccine virus shedding (Odds ratio 1.5, 95% CI = 1.10-1.89), p = 0.002. The findings suggest that harbouring higher counts of LPS-rich bacteria can increase the oral rotavirus vaccine take in infants.

Several risk factors have been associated with SARS-CoV-2 infections and severity of COVID-19 disease it causes. This study investigated whether variations in histo-blood group antigen (HBGA) expression can predispose individuals to SARS-CoV-2 infections and severity of the disease. Nasopharyngeal swabs, randomly selected from SARS-CoV-2 positive and SARS-CoV-2 negative individuals, were tested for Lewis and H-type 1 HBGA phenotypes by ELISA using monoclonal antibodies specific to Lewis a, Lewis b and H type 1 antigens. The most common Lewis HBGA phenotype among all study participants was Lewis a-b+ (46%), followed by Lewis a-b- (24%), Lewis a+b- and Lewis a+b+ (15% each), while 55% of the study participants were H-type 1. Although SARS-CoV-2 negative individuals had a lower likelihood of having a Lewis a-b- phenotype compared to their SARS-CoV-2 positives counterparts (OR: 0.53, 95% C.I: 0.255-1.113), it did not reach statistical significance (P = 0.055). The frequency of Lewis a+b+, Lewis a+B-, Lewis a-b+, H type 1 positive and H type 1 negative were consistent between SARS-CoV-2 positive and SARS-CoV-2 negative individuals. When stratified according to severity of the disease, individuals with Lewis a+b- phenotype had a higher likelihood of developing mild COVID-19 symptoms (OR: 3.27, 95% CI; 0.9604-11.1), but was not statistically significant (P = 0.055), while Lewis a-b- phenotype was predictive of severe COVID-19 symptoms (OR: 4.3, 95% CI: 1.274-14.81), P = 0.016. In conclusion, individuals with Lewis a-b- phenotype were less likely to be infected by SARS-CoV-2, but when infected, they were at risk of severe COVID-19.

This paper uses a robust method of spatial epidemiological analysis to assess the spatial growth rate of multiple lineages of SARS-CoV-2 in the local authority areas of England, September 2020-December 2021. Using the genomic surveillance records of the COVID-19 Genomics UK (COG-UK) Consortium, the analysis identifies a substantial (7.6-fold) difference in the average rate of spatial growth of 37 sample lineages, from the slowest (Delta AY.4.3) to the fastest (Omicron BA.1). Spatial growth of the Omicron (B.1.1.529 and BA) variant was found to be 2.81× faster than the Delta (B.1.617.2 and AY) variant and 3.76× faster than the Alpha (B.1.1.7 and Q) variant. In addition to AY.4.2 (a designated variant under investigation, VUI-21OCT-01), three Delta sublineages (AY.43, AY.98 and AY.120) were found to display a statistically faster rate of spatial growth than the parent lineage and would seem to merit further investigation. We suggest that the monitoring of spatial growth rates is a potentially valuable adjunct to outbreak response procedures for emerging SARS-CoV-2 variants in a defined population.

Introduction While regarded as an effective surgical approach to vestibular schwannoma (VS) resection, the translabyrinthine (TL) approach is not without complications. It has been postulated that postoperative cerebral venous sinus thrombosis (pCVST) may occur as a result of injury and manipulation during surgery. Our objective was to identify radiologic, surgical, and patient-specific risk factors that may be associated with pCVST. Methods The Institutional Review Board (IRB) approval was obtained and the medical records of adult patients with VS who underwent TL craniectomy at University Hospitals Cleveland Medical Center between 2009 and 2019 were reviewed. Demographic data, radiographic measurements, and tumor characteristics were collected. Outcomes assessed included pCVST and the modified Rankin score (mRS). Results Sixty-one patients ultimately met inclusion criteria for the study. Ten patients demonstrated radiographic evidence of thrombus. Patients who developed pCVST demonstrated shorter internal auditory canal (IAC) to sinus distance (mean: 22.5 vs. 25.0 mm, p = 0.044) and significantly smaller petrous angles (mean: 26.3 vs. 32.7 degrees, p = 0.0045). Patients with good mRS scores (<3) appeared also to have higher mean petrous angles (32.5 vs. 26.8, p = 0.016). Koos' grading and tumor size, in our study, were not associated with thrombosis. Conclusion More acute petrous angle and shorter IAC to sinus distance are objective anatomic variables associated with pCVST in TL surgical approaches.

Introduction The incidence of vestibular schwannoma is reported as 12 to 54 new cases per million per year, increasing over time. These patients usually present with unilateral sensorineural hearing loss, tinnitus, or vertigo. Rarely, these patients present with symptoms of hydrocephalus or vision changes. Objective The study aimed to evaluate the surgical management of vestibular schwannoma at a single institution and to identify factors that may contribute to hydrocephalus, papilledema, and the need for pre-resection diversion of cerebrospinal fluid. Patients and Methods A retrospective review examining the data of 203 patients with vestibular schwannoma managed with surgical resection from May 2008 to May 2020. We stratified patients into five different groups to analyze: tumors with a diameter of ≥40 mm, clinical evidence of hydrocephalus, and of papilledema, and patients who underwent pre-resection cerebrospinal fluid (CSF) diversion. Results From May 2008 to May 2020, 203 patients were treated with surgical resection. Patients with tumors ≥40 mm were more likely to present with visual symptoms ( p < 0.001). Presentation with hydrocephalus was associated with larger tumor size ( p < 0.001) as well as concomitant visual symptoms and papilledema ( p < 0.001). Patients with visual symptoms presented at a younger age ( p = 0.002) and with larger tumors ( p < 0.001). Conclusion This case series highlights the rare presentation of vision changes and hydrocephalus in patients with vestibular schwannoma. We recommend urgent CSF diversion for patients with visual symptoms and hydrocephalus, followed by definitive resection. Further, vision may still deteriorate even after CSF diversion and tumor resection.

The study tested the hypothesis that harboring high levels of histo-blood group antigen-expressing Enerobactero cloacae is a risk factor for norovirus diarrhea. The fecal E. cloacae abundance in diarrheic norovirus positive (DNP), non-diarrheic norovirus negative (NDNN), diarrhea norovirus negative (DNN), and non-diarrhea norovirus positive (NDNP) infants was determined by qPCR, and the risk of norovirus diarrhea was assessed by logistical regression. DNP infants contained significantly higher counts of E. cloacae than NDNN and DNN infants, p = .0294, and 0.0001, respectively. The risk of norovirus diarrhea was significantly high in infants with higher counts of E. cloacae than those with lower counts, p = .009. Harboring higher counts of E. cloacae is a risk factor for norovirus diarrhea.

Sacrococcygeal myxopapillary ependymoma (MPE) is an uncommon type I glial tumor detected most frequently in the lumbosacral area of adolescents and children. It is usually presented as an intradural ependymal tumor that originates from the filum terminale and other locations within the ventricular system along the craniospinal axis. In rare cases, however, MPE may develop as a primary subcutaneous tumor in the sacrococcygeal area. Tumors can also appear as a dorsal sacrococcygeal growth or subcutaneous nodule. In this case report, we describe a rare case presenting as a subcutaneous sacrococcygeal mass in an elderly female that was subsequently resected and confirmed as subcutaneous MPE. The current standard treatment for MPE is maximal surgical resection with or without postoperative radiotherapy based on the locoregional extent and histological grading. However, there is limited evidence that radiotherapy for oligometastatic foci improves longevity or extends the time to recurrence. In addition to this case report, we provide a comprehensive review of similar cases and case series in the medical literature. Prospective studies evaluating the efficacy of resection and/or radiotherapy are required for improved management of extradural MPE.

The storage of granular materials is a critical process in industry, which has driven research into flow in silos. Varying material properties, such as particle size, can cause segregation of mixtures. This work seeks to elucidate the effects of size differences and determine how using a flow-correcting insert mitigates segregation during silo discharge. A rotating table was used to collect mustard seeds discharged from a three-dimensional (3D)-printed silo. This was loaded with bidisperse mixtures of varying proportions. A 3D-printed biconical insert was suspended near the hopper exit to assess its effect on the flow. Samples were analysed to determine the mass fractions of small particle species. The experiments without the insert resulted in patterns consistent with segregation. Introducing the insert into the silo eliminated the observed segregation during discharge. Discrete element method simulations of silo discharge were performed with and without the insert. These results mirrored the physical experiment and, when complimented with coarse graining analysis, explained the effect of the insert. Most of the segregation occurs at the grain-air free surface and is driven by large velocity gradients. In the silo with an insert, the velocity gradient at the free surface is greatly reduced, hence, so is the degree of segregation.

The complete mitogenome of the northern long-eared bat (Myotis septentrionalis) was determined to be 17,362 bp and contained 22 tRNA genes, 2 rRNA genes and one control region. The whole genome base composition was 33.8% GC. Phylogenetic analysis suggests that M. septentrionalis be positioned next to M. auriculus in the Nearctic subclade of the Myotis genus. This complete mitochondrial genome provides essential molecular markers for resolving phylogeny and future conservation efforts.

Histo-blood group antigens are recognized by rotaviruses in a P- genotype dependent manner and their frequency in a population can influence fecal virus shedding. This study investigated the rate of fecal shedding of Rotarix vaccine and its association with HBGA phenotype distribution in South Africa. Stool and saliva specimens were collected from 150 infants attending immunization on the day of both first and second doses and 7 days later. Virus shedding was detected by real-time qPCR while HBGA phenotypes in saliva were determined by enzyme linked immunosorbent assay. Vaccine virus shedding was higher (23.6%) after the first dose than the second dose (4.7%). About 77% of virus-shedding infants were secretors (OR = 129; 95% CI, 6.088 - 2733), compared with none of non-virus shedding infants. Non-secretor status was significantly associated with low vaccine virus shedding while the likelihood of shedding was significantly higher in secretors.

Integration of multiple, heterogeneous sensors is a challenging problem across a range of applications. Prominent among these are multi-target tracking, where one must combine observations from different sensor types in a meaningful and efficient way to track multiple targets. Because different sensors have differing error models, we seek a theoretically justified quantification of the agreement among ensembles of sensors, both overall for a sensor collection, and also at a fine-grained level specifying pairwise and multi-way interactions among sensors. We demonstrate that the theory of mathematical sheaves provides a unified answer to this need, supporting both quantitative and qualitative data. Furthermore, the theory provides algorithms to globalize data across the network of deployed sensors, and to diagnose issues when the data do not globalize cleanly. We demonstrate and illustrate the utility of sheaf-based tracking models based on experimental data of a wild population of black bears in Asheville, North Carolina. A measurement model involving four sensors deployed among the bears and the team of scientists charged with tracking their location is deployed. This provides a sheaf-based integration model which is small enough to fully interpret, but of sufficient complexity to demonstrate the sheaf's ability to recover a holistic picture of the locations and behaviors of both individual bears and the bear-human tracking system. A statistical approach was developed in parallel for comparison, a dynamic linear model which was estimated using a Kalman filter. This approach also recovered bear and human locations and sensor accuracies. When the observations are normalized into a common coordinate system, the structure of the dynamic linear observation model recapitulates the structure of the sheaf model, demonstrating the canonicity of the sheaf-based approach. However, when the observations are not so normalized, the sheaf model still remains valid.

OBJECTIVE: Enlargement of the vestibular aqueduct (EVA) is one of the most common congenital malformations in pediatric patients presenting with sensorineural or mixed hearing loss. The relationship between vestibular aqueduct (VA) morphology and hearing loss across sex is not well characterized. This study assesses VA morphology and frequency-specific hearing thresholds with sex as the primary predictor of interest. MATERIALS AND METHODS: A retrospective, longitudinal, and repeated-measures study was used. 47 patients at an academic tertiary care center with hearing loss and a record of CT scan of the internal auditory canal were candidates, and included upon meeting EVA criteria after confirmatory measurements of vestibular aqueduct midpoint and operculum widths. Audiometric measures included pure-tone average and frequency-specific thresholds. RESULTS: Of the 47 patients (23 female and 24 male), 79 total ears were affected by EVA; the median age at diagnosis was 6.60 years. After comparing morphological measurements between sexes, ears from female patients were observed to have a greater average operculum width (3.25 vs. 2.70 mm for males, p = 0.006) and a greater average VA midpoint width (2.80 vs. 1.90 mm for males, p = 0.004). After adjusting for morphology, male patients' ears had pure-tone average thresholds 17.6 dB greater than female patients' ears (95% CI, 3.8 to 31.3 dB). CONCLUSIONS: Though females seem to have greater enlargement of the vestibular aqueduct, this difference does not extend to hearing loss. Therefore, our results indicate that criteria for EVA diagnoses may benefit from re-evaluation. Further exploration into morphological and audiometric discrepancies across sex may help inform both clinician and patient expectations.

The development of antibiotic resistance and dissemination of its determinants is an emerging public health problem as it compromises treatment options of infections that were, until recently, treatable. Investigation of outbreaks of vancomycin resistant enterococci (VRE) suggests that the environment serves as a significant reservoir for antibiotic resistance genes (ARGs). However, there is a paucity of data regarding the presence of ARGs in the water sources in South Africa. In this study, water samples collected from wastewater treatment plants (WWTPs), surface water and hospital sewage were screened for enterococci harbouring genes conferring resistance to four classes of antibiotics. Enterococci isolates harbouring ARGs were detected in raw influent and treated wastewater discharge from WWTPs and hospital sewage water. Plasmid and transposon encoded ermB (macrolide), tetM and tetL (tetracycline) as well as aph(3')-IIIa (aminoglycosides) genes were frequently detected among the isolates, especially in E. faecalis. The presence of enterococci harbouring ARGs in the treated wastewater suggest that ARGs are discharged into the environment where their proliferation could be perpetuated. Among the enterococci clonal complexes (CCs) recovered from wastewater were E. faecium CC17 (ST18), which is frequently associated with hospital outbreaks and a novel E. faecalis sequence type (ST), ST780.

OBJECTIVE: Investigate the relationships between food security status and cooking self-efficacy and food preparation behaviors among college students. METHODS: Students living off campus while attending the University of Alabama completed an online survey between February and April 2016. Food security status was assessed using the Adult Food Security Survey Module. Cooking self-efficacy and food preparation behaviors were assessed using validated questionnaires. Multiple regression analysis was used to test for significant differences in cooking self-efficacy and food preparation scores by food security status. RESULTS: Among respondents (n = 368), 38.3% were food insecure. Very low food secure students had significantly lower cooking self-efficacy scores and food preparation scores than food secure students (P = .001). CONCLUSIONS AND IMPLICATIONS: Preparing meals at home is less common for very low food secure students, and these students demonstrate less confidence in cooking ability. Further study of food-related decisions and trade-offs under resource constraints are needed.

Allogeneic transplantation (allo-HCT) has led to the cure of HIV in one individual, raising the question of whether transplantation can eradicate the HIV reservoir. To test this, we here present a model of allo-HCT in SHIV-infected, cART-suppressed nonhuman primates. We infect rhesus macaques with SHIV-1157ipd3N4, suppress them with cART, then transplant them using MHC-haploidentical allogeneic donors during continuous cART. Transplant results in ~100% myeloid donor chimerism, and up to 100% T-cell chimerism. Between 9 and 47 days post-transplant, terminal analysis shows that while cell-associated SHIV DNA levels are reduced in the blood and in lymphoid organs post-transplant, the SHIV reservoir persists in multiple organs, including the brain. Sorting of donor-vs.-recipient cells reveals that this reservoir resides in recipient cells. Moreover, tetramer analysis indicates a lack of virus-specific donor immunity post-transplant during continuous cART. These results suggest that early post-transplant, allo-HCT is insufficient for recipient reservoir eradication despite high-level donor chimerism and GVHD.

The introduction of oral rotavirus vaccines (ORVVs) has led to a reduction in number of hospitalisations and deaths due to rotavirus (RV) infection. However, the efficacy of the vaccines has been varied with low-income countries showing significantly lower efficacy as compared to high-income countries. The reasons for the disparity are not fully understood but are thought to be multi-factorial. In this review article, we discuss the concept that the disparity in the efficacy of oral rotavirus vaccines between the higher and lower socio-economical countries could be due the nature of the bacteria that colonises and establishes in the gut early in life. We further discuss recent studies that has demonstrated significant correlations between the composition of the gut bacteria and the immunogenicity of oral vaccines, and their implications in the development of novel oral RV vaccines or redesigning the current ones for maximum impact.

OBJECTIVES: To evaluate the long-term efficacy of endolymphatic sac shunt techniques with and without local steroid administration. STUDY DESIGN: Retrospective case series and patient survey. SETTING: Tertiary university hospital. PATIENTS: Meniere's disease (MD) patients that failed medical therapy and subsequently underwent an endolymphatic sac shunt procedure. All patients had definitive or probable MD and at least 18-months of follow-up. INTERVENTIONS: Three variations on endolymphatic sac decompression with shunt placement were performed: Group A received no local steroids, Group B received intratympanic dexamethasone prior to incision, and Group C received dexamethasone via both intratympanic injection and direct endolymphatic sac instillation. MAIN OUTCOME MEASURE(S): Vertigo control, hearing results, and survey responses. RESULTS: Between 2002 and 2013, 124 patients with MD underwent endolymphatic sac decompression with shunt placement. 53 patients met inclusion criteria. Groups A, B, and C had 6 patients, 20 patients, and 27 patients, respectively. Mean follow-up was 56months. Vertigo control improved in 66%, 83%, and 93% of Groups A, B, and C. Functional level improved for Group B (-2.0) and Group C (-2.2) but was unchanged in Group A. Pure-tone average and speech discrimination scores changed by +22dB and -30%, +6dB and -13%, and +6dB and -5% in Groups A, B, and C. The long-term hearing results were significantly better with steroids (Groups B and C) according to the AAO-HNS 1995 criteria but did not meet significance on non-parametric testing. CONCLUSIONS: Endolymphatic sac shunt procedures may benefit from steroid instillation at the time of shunt placement.

HYPOTHESIS: Phosphorus and vitamin D (calcitriol) supplementation in the Phex mouse, a murine model for endolymphatic hydrops (ELH), will improve otic capsule mineralization and secondarily ameliorate the postnatal development of ELH and sensorineural hearing loss (SNHL). BACKGROUND: Male Phex mice have X-linked hypophosphatemic rickets (XLH), which includes osteomalacia of the otic capsule. The treatment for XLH is supplementation with phosphorus and calcitriol. The effect of this treatment has never been studied on otic capsule bone and it is unclear if improving the otic capsule bone could impact the mice's postnatal development of ELH and SNHL. METHODS: Four cohorts were studied: 1) wild-type control, 2) Phex control, 3) Phex prevention, and 4) Phex rescue. The control groups were not given any dietary supplementation. The Phex prevention group was supplemented with phosphorus added to its drinking water and intraperitoneal calcitriol from postnatal day (P) 7-P40. The Phex rescue group was also supplemented with phosphorus and calcium but only from P20 to P40. At P40, all mice underwent auditory brainstem response (ABR) testing, serum analysis, and temporal bone histologic analysis. Primary outcome was otic capsule mineralization. Secondary outcomes were degree of SNHL and presence ELH. RESULTS: Both treatment groups had markedly improved otic capsule mineralization with less osteoid deposition. The improved otic capsule mineralized did not prevent the development of ELH or SNHL. CONCLUSION: Supplementation with phosphorus and calcitriol improves otic capsule bone morphology in the Phex male mouse but does not alter development of ELH or SNHL.
